
FDS Nano Double Screw Pump
Introducing the World’s Smallest Double Screw Pump!
Fristam Pumps next-generation solution for hygienic low-flow pumping and dosing is a downsized version of our standard FDS pump. This innovative new pump design has been meticulously engineered for accuracy and performance when pumping smaller quantities of 5-900l/h or performing a dosing function.
Key Benefits
3 pumps in 1: Unlike other low flow pumping technologies, the FDS Nano can alternate between operating at low speeds for pumping and dosing and high speeds (up to 4,000rpm) to self-clean with CIP. It is therefore equally suitable for:
- Low flow, gentle product pumping (viscosities up to 1 million cP)
- Dosing – Either shots; up to 70 shots per minute or continuous dosing
- CIP – high velocity pumping up to 4,000rpm
Hygienic Design: The FDS Nano internal design is open and free from dead areas. Fully flushed areas around the mechanical seals ensure effective cleaning during CIP, with no need to disassemble the pump to clean it, enhancing operational efficiency.
Gentle Product Handling: The twin screw design of the FDS Nano ensures smooth, low-shear product handling.
Effortless pumping, even in tough conditions: The FDS Nano handles up to 70% air in the line without air-locking and viscosities up to 1 million cP are conveyed with ease.
With the capability of achieving such low flow rates, Fristam are now able to enter new areas of processing:
- Pre-production phases of manufacturing – where smaller quantities of ingredients are pumped in a ‘kitchen’ environment to make up batches.
- Towards the end of production – for dosing and filling lines.
- Pilot plants pumps – The FDS Nano is a scaled down FDS, making it the ideal pilot plant pump. Customers can judge a direct miniature of the technology on a smaller scale, before opting for a larger pump when production is scaled up.
Replacing inferior low flow technology:
The FDS Nano is a great replacement for AOD (Air operated diaphragm pumps) or gear pumps for pumping small volumes of product. However, neither pump type is optimised for hygiene or pumping shear sensitive products.
